Transaction 3abcfbafa1232abe808e1ac8cc061d0b8751d2c80765a193e912ceb8e2a30575
1 Input
1 Output
-
3abcfbafa1232abe808e1ac8cc061d0b8751d2c80765a193e912ceb8e2a30575:0
- value
- 731324
- script pubkey
- OP_PUSHNUM_1 OP_PUSHBYTES_32 3d7ee4feadcb16d14f3a2371f0d1bb3000773e26e5623cdd3d05c4c32d01e86f
- address
- bc1p84lwfl4devtdzne6ydclp5dmxqq8w03xu43rehfaqhzvxtgpaphssx6ufq